Since the 1940s, the UFO (Unidentified Flying Object) phenomenon has gained notoriety in the United States due to the mysteries that surround it. The mystery surrounding these alleged invasions has received a new chapter in Florida. A police officer photographed a UFO-like object being pursued by a US Air Force plane on Conch Beach. Officer Charles Moruz said he was patrolling the beach when he spotted a Coast Guard aircraft pursuing a dark metal object in the direction of the bay.
“I saw a Coast Guard plane fly over the bay and then I saw them coming back into the bay. I thought, “What the hell is this?” Looking up, I saw a big black thing in the sky. Based on the size of the plane in the sky, I estimate it was at least the size of a car or maybe a small plane,” Moruz said.
The policeman noticed that the plane seemed to change course, as if intent on trying to pursue. As he did so, the object, which until that moment had been virtually stationary, suddenly changed direction and accelerated at an incredible and seemingly impossible speed.
Moroz commented on the object’s speed. “This thing must have been traveling at least 800 km/h. It just fired like a rocket towards the horizon and just disappeared,” he said.
No official explanation for this sighting has been given, but Moruz insists it was not a drone.”
According to the officer, he visits the area daily and knows how drones fly. The Coast Guard, for its part, declined to confirm whether the incident took place.
